★ 5★ 4★ 3★ 2★ 1Such an amazing place. The food was delicious and unique. It's my 1st time having Basque style food. There was a few of us and we sampled some Pintxo, Entrees and dessert. All really yummy. The wine suggestions for our table was spot on. The servers know their wines and the food so well, it enhanced the dining experience. If you like art walls, this is your spot. Just beautifully done and everywhere you look. The whole place was well designed to create a warm, unique, and inviting atmosphere. The chef even comes out to check on you and he's such a genuine charming man. I can't wait to go back.

September 09 · Steve WellmannWhat an unexpected gem. Tucked into a quiet strip center, El Basque transports you far from Florida—somewhere between an old-world Basque tavern and a buzzy New York neighborhood spot. The vibe is right: warm, understated, and somehow both cozy and elevated.We shared a beautiful bottle of Tempranillo and made our way through a selection of dishes that felt both classic and soulful. The olives and gazpacho were the perfect start—bright, briny, and refreshing. Escargot was rich and indulgent, scallops and shrimp were perfectly cooked, and the flank steak and short ribs were deeply flavorful and comforting. Everything was beautifully presented without any pretense.The chef clearly brings New York pedigree, but with a grounded sense of tradition that shines through the menu. Prices are incredibly fair for the quality—this place delivers on value without sacrificing experience.It’s the kind of spot you almost want to keep to yourself… but I already can’t wait to go back.
